How much does a Toyota RAV4 battery cost?

5Answers
KeeganMarie
06/07/2026, 07:42:05 AM

Replacing a Toyota RAV4 battery costs between $100 and $300 for a standard 12V battery in gasoline models, while hybrid models require a high-voltage traction battery costing $2,000 to $8,000+ for a replacement. The final price hinges on your RAV4's model year, engine type, the battery technology chosen, and whether you install it yourself.

For gasoline-powered RAV4s, the 12V starter battery is a routine replacement. Market data from major retailers like AutoZone and Advance Auto Parts shows common group sizes (35, H5, H6) priced between $180 and $280. If your vehicle has start-stop technology, it requires a more robust Absorbent Glass Mat (AGM) battery, which typically costs $220 to $320. Dealer installation can add $50 to $100 to the part cost. A typical total outlay at a dealership, including parts and labor, often lands between $250 and $400.

For RAV4 Hybrid models, the cost structure is entirely different. The critical component is the high-voltage nickel-metal hydride or lithium-ion battery pack. A brand-new replacement battery pack from Toyota can cost between $3,500 and $8,000 for the part alone, with total installed costs reaching up to $9,000 at a dealership. However, a growing remanufactured and reconditioned battery sector offers significant savings, with reliable options available in the $2,000 to $4,500 range, including installation. Toyota's hybrid battery warranty also provides long-term coverage, often 10 years or 150,000 miles from the original in-service date in many states, which can mitigate owner costs.

Battery TypeVehicle ModelPart Cost Range (USD)Key Factors & Notes
Standard 12V (Flooded Lead-Acid)Gasoline RAV4$100 - $200Base option for older models without start-stop. Prices vary by brand (e.g., EverStart, DieHard).
AGM 12V BatteryGasoline RAV4 (with start-stop)$220 - $320Required for newer models; longer life and better deep-cycle performance.
High-Voltage Traction Battery (New OEM)RAV4 Hybrid$3,500 - $8,000+Factory part from Toyota. Highest cost, usually installed at dealerships.
High-Voltage Traction Battery (Remanufactured)RAV4 Hybrid$2,000 - $4,500Cost-effective reliable alternative. Includes core exchange and professional installation.

Beyond the battery itself, consider labor and warranty. Professional installation for a 12V battery is straightforward but adds to the cost. For hybrid batteries, professional installation is mandatory and complex, factored into the higher prices. Always check the warranty—mainstream 12V batteries come with 2-5 year free replacement plans, while hybrid battery services offer warranties from 1 to 5 years, a crucial indicator of service confidence. Your final cost is a balance of part quality, installation expertise, and warranty security.

I run a small independent shop. Here’s the straightforward deal for RAV4 batteries. Gas model? You’re looking at $200 to $400 out the door for a good quality AGM battery and my labor. I’ll match the group size and register the battery to your car’s computer if it needs it. Hybrid battery issues? I don’t crack those open. I partner with a certified hybrid battery specialist. They come to my shop, test the pack, and usually offer a reconditioned module replacement or a full reman unit. That saves you a fortune compared to the dealer. My customers usually pay between $2,500 and $4,000 for a complete, warranted hybrid battery service.

When my 2019 RAV4 Hybrid started showing a warning light, my stomach dropped because of the battery cost stories. I called the dealership first—they quoted a dizzying amount for diagnostic and potential replacement. Instead, I found a service that specializes in hybrid batteries. They sent a technician to my driveway with a scan tool. He identified a single weak module in the pack, not the whole thing. They replaced just that module and rebalanced the pack right there. Total cost was under $1,500, and it came with a 3-year warranty. The lesson? Don’t panic and assume you need a whole new $8,000 battery. Get a proper diagnosis from a hybrid expert first.

Want the lowest upfront cost for a gas RAV4 battery? Do it yourself. Go to any major auto parts store website, use their vehicle lookup tool for your exact year and trim. It’ll tell you the correct group size (like H6 or 35). You can often find a standard lead-acid battery for around $120-$180. Watch a quick YouTube video on how to replace it—it’s usually just two bolts. Remember to connect positive first, negative last. This avoids the $50-$100 installation fee. Just be sure your model doesn’t require an AGM battery; if it does, the DIY price starts around $220. Keep your receipt for the warranty.

Thinking long-term, the battery choice is about value, not just price. For a gasoline RAV4, spending an extra $80 on a top-tier AGM battery over a basic one is wise if your vehicle calls for it. It handles start-stop cycles better and lasts longer, saving you from another replacement in two years. For hybrids, the math is bigger. A $3,000 remanufactured pack with a 5-year warranty offers much better value over five years than a $1,500 repair with a 1-year warranty that might fail again. The dealer’s new battery is a premium option, often justified only if you plan to keep the car for a decade more. Always factor in the warranty length and the installer’s reputation—it’s insurance for your investment. The cheapest option now can be the most expensive over time.

Will there be any impact if one tire is different from the other three?

There will be an impact if one tire is different from the other three. In the case of replacing only one tire, the new tire must have a tread groove depth close to that of the other tire on the same axle; otherwise, it may cause issues such as vehicle deviation. Precautions for tire replacement: The purchased tire specifications must first be consistent with the original tire specifications installed on the vehicle. Tires of the same specification, structure, manufacturer, and tread should be installed on the same axle. Tire replacement should comply with the manufacturer's recommendations: When replacing, the tire specifications must meet the requirements and recommendations of the vehicle manufacturer, meaning the load index of the replacement tire must be greater than or equal to that of the original tire, and the speed rating of the replacement tire must be greater than or equal to that of the original tire.
